George F Jones Scholarship Eligibiltiy

A current male of female student who is involved in the sport as a player, coach or administrator:

  1. Involved in the development and expansion of the game
  2. Enrolled in a full-time degree (graduate or undergraduate), diploma or certificate program at a Canadian college or university for the academic year commencing in the year in which the scholarship is granted. Students commencing their studies in the Fall are eligible.

General Guidelines:

  1. Unsuccessful applicants may reapply in a subsequent year.
  2. Successful recipients may not apply again.
  3. The scholarship is conditional upon the acceptance and continuance in the educational program of the applicant's choice. Verification of acceptance will be required.
  4. Applications must be mailed or couriered. Faxes or e-mails will not be accepted.
  5. The award recipient must agree to have her name and photograph publicized. He or she must be prepared to promote the scholarship as requested.

Selection Criteria:

  1. Involved and devoted to the game but does not have to be an active player.
  2. Must be involved in helping expand the game of rugby in places like inner cities, first nation reserves, small towns, immigrant communities etc.
  3. Must be able to demonstrate current involvement in the sport.

Application Requirements:

  1. A completed application form;
  2. A letter, not more than 250 words, describing the reasons why you would be a worthy recipient of the George F. Jones Scholarship. Include your contributions to the rugby community, how you have helped expand the game, other volunteer activities, your academic achievements, your most important accomplishments and your future goals;
  3. Two letters of reference from the two individuals named in your application. One must be someone who has been involved with you in the rugby community;
